Well, you can download "GParted" and install it into a USB drive. Make sure you follow the procedures correctly:
http://gparted.sourceforge.net/liveusb.php
Alternatively you can use Acronis Disk Director and use that from a USB drive, but the USB drive should be in FAT32 format for Acronis Disk Director to work when you boot.
This way, you don't need a CD-ROM drive to partition your HD.
